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
privacy-compliance
Guide teams through GDPR, CCPA/CPRA, and international privacy law obligations including DPA reviews, data subject access and deletion requests, cross-border data transfers, breach notification, and regulatory monitoring. Use when evaluating data processing agreements, handling DSAR or right-to-delete requests, assessing international data transfer mechanisms, reviewing privacy notices, or tracking privacy regulation changes.
vm0-ai/vm0-skills 50
-
research-synthesis
Transform raw user research data into actionable product insights, personas, and prioritized opportunities. Activate for interview analysis, survey interpretation, usability test findings, support ticket pattern mining, behavioral data synthesis, thematic coding, affinity diagramming, persona building, or opportunity scoring.
vm0-ai/vm0-skills 50
-
elevenlabs
ElevenLabs API for text-to-speech and voice. Use when user mentions "ElevenLabs", "text to speech", "voice cloning", or "AI voice".
vm0-ai/vm0-skills 50
-
journal-entries
Construct and review journal entries with correct debit/credit structure, supporting calculations, and approval workflows. Use for month-end accruals, prepaid amortization, depreciation entries, payroll booking, revenue recognition journal entries, manual adjustments, recurring entries, reversing entries, or intercompany journal entries.
vm0-ai/vm0-skills 50
-
htmlcsstoimage
HTML/CSS to Image API for rendering. Use when user mentions "HTML to image", "render HTML", "screenshot", or "convert to image".
vm0-ai/vm0-skills 50
-
similarweb
Similarweb API for web analytics. Use when user mentions "Similarweb", "website traffic", "competitor analysis", or market intelligence.
vm0-ai/vm0-skills 50
-
cal-com
Cal.com open-source scheduling API. Use when user mentions "Cal.com", "cal.com", "open source scheduling", "booking", "event types", or asks about interview or meeting scheduling.
vm0-ai/vm0-skills 50
-
account-reconciliation
Perform account reconciliations comparing general ledger balances against subledgers, bank statements, or external records. Use for bank reconciliation, GL-to-subledger reconciliation, intercompany reconciliation, balance sheet reconciliation, reconciling item analysis, outstanding item aging, or clearing open items.
vm0-ai/vm0-skills 50
-
discord
Discord API for servers and messages. Use when user mentions "Discord", "discord.com", "discord.gg", shares a Discord link, "Discord server", or asks about Discord bots.
vm0-ai/vm0-skills 50
-
hume
Hume AI API for emotion analysis. Use when user mentions "Hume", "emotion AI", "sentiment analysis", or voice emotion detection.
vm0-ai/vm0-skills 50
-
copywriting
Write and edit marketing copy for any channel — blogs, emails, social posts, landing pages, press releases, case studies, ads, and web pages. Trigger on requests for drafting content, writing headlines, crafting CTAs, SEO copywriting, email subject lines, social captions, or any persuasive marketing text.
vm0-ai/vm0-skills 50
-
imgur
Imgur API for image hosting. Use when user mentions "Imgur", "upload image", "image hosting", or asks about image sharing.
vm0-ai/vm0-skills 50
-
streak
Streak CRM API for Gmail. Use when user mentions "Streak", "Gmail CRM", "email CRM", or pipeline in Gmail.
vm0-ai/vm0-skills 50
-
slack
Slack API for messages and channels. Use when user mentions "Slack", "slack.com", shares a Slack link, "send to Slack", "Slack channel", or asks about workspace.
vm0-ai/vm0-skills 50
-
discord-webhook
Discord Webhook API for sending messages. Use when user says "send Discord message", "Discord webhook", or "post to Discord".
vm0-ai/vm0-skills 50
-
slack-webhook
Slack Webhook for posting messages. Use when user says "post to Slack", "Slack webhook", or "send Slack notification".
vm0-ai/vm0-skills 50
-
github-copilot
GitHub Copilot API for AI coding assistance. Use when user mentions "Copilot", "GitHub Copilot", "AI coding", or asks about Copilot features.
vm0-ai/vm0-skills 50
-
wrike
Wrike API for project management. Use when user mentions "Wrike", "wrike.com", shares a Wrike link, "Wrike task", or asks about Wrike workspace.
vm0-ai/vm0-skills 50
-
zapier
Zapier API for workflow automation. Use when user mentions "Zapier", "zap", "automation", or asks about connecting apps.
vm0-ai/vm0-skills 50
-
competitor-matrix
Conduct competitive analysis with feature comparison matrices, positioning teardowns, win/loss evaluation, and market trend assessment. Activate when researching competitors, building a feature comparison table, evaluating competitive positioning, preparing a competitive brief, analyzing win/loss patterns, mapping the competitive landscape, or assessing market threats and opportunities.
vm0-ai/vm0-skills 50
-
campaign-strategy
Plan and structure marketing campaigns — set objectives, segment audiences, choose channels, build content calendars, allocate budgets, and define KPIs. Trigger on requests for campaign planning, product launch strategy, go-to-market plans, content scheduling, media mix decisions, campaign briefs, or marketing budget allocation.
vm0-ai/vm0-skills 50
-
openai
OpenAI API for GPT models. Use when user mentions "OpenAI", "GPT", "ChatGPT API", or asks about OpenAI models (do NOT use for Anthropic/Claude).
vm0-ai/vm0-skills 50
-
product-metrics
Define, instrument, and analyze product metrics across acquisition, activation, engagement, retention, and monetization. Activate when setting OKRs, designing a metrics dashboard, running a weekly or monthly metrics review, diagnosing metric movements, choosing KPIs for a product area, building a metrics framework, or evaluating product health.
vm0-ai/vm0-skills 50
-
canva
Canva API for design creation. Use when user mentions "Canva", "create design", "Canva template", or asks about design graphics.
vm0-ai/vm0-skills 50